클라우드 프록시 및 대상 시스템과의 통신
클라우드 프록시와 대상 시스템의 핸드셰이크 중에 필요한 사전 요구 사항을 완료합니다.
대상 시스템과 클라우드 프록시의 핸드셰이크에는 다음과 같은 사전 요구 사항이 필요합니다.
- Telegraf가 실행되어야 하는 대상 시스템, 클라우드 프록시 및VMware Aria Operations의 시간이 동기화되어야 합니다.vCenter Server클라우드 계정으로 관리되는 VM의 경우 VM이 배포된 ESXi 인스턴스,vCenter Server, VM,VMware Aria Operations및 클라우드 프록시의 시간이 동기화되어야 합니다.
- 대상 시스템은클라우드 프록시및 애플리케이션 모니터링 고가용성이 활성화된 수집기 그룹의 가상 IP에서 포트 443, 4505 및 4506에 액세스할 수 있어야 합니다. 대상 시스템에서 다음 명령을 실행하여 액세스를 확인할 수 있습니다.
- Linux 시스템의 경우:timeout 10 bash -c "</dev/tcp/{cloudproxy_fqdn_or_virtual_IP}/4505" echo $? timeout 10 bash -c "</dev/tcp/{cloudproxy_fqdn_or_virtual_IP}/4506" echo $? timeout 10 bash -c "</dev/tcp/{cloudproxy_fqdn_or_virtual_IP}/443" echo $?
- Windows 시스템의 경우:wget.exe --spider -t 1 -T 10 {cloudproxy_fqdn_or_virtual_IP}:4505 wget.exe --spider -t 1 -T 10 {cloudproxy_fqdn_or_virtual_IP}:4506 wget.exe --spider -t 1 -T 10 {cloudproxy_fqdn_or_virtual_IP}:443Windows 시스템에wget.exe가 없는 경우 설치를 시도한 후 파일 탐색기에서%temp%폴더 또는 상위 폴더로 이동한 후wget.exe를 검색합니다.위의 명령에서는 애플리케이션 모니터링 고가용성이 활성화된 수집기 그룹의 경우 가상 IP를 사용합니다. 개별 클라우드 프록시의 경우 또는 애플리케이션 모니터링 고가용성이 비활성화된 수집기 그룹에 속하는 클라우드 프록시의 경우 클라우드 프록시 FQDN을 사용합니다.
- 사용자의 에이전트 설치에 필요한 권한은 사용자 계정 사전 요구 사항 페이지에 설명되어 있습니다.
- 대상 시스템 구성 요구 사항입니다.
- Linux 요구 사항명령:/bin/bash, sudo, tar, awk, curl패키지:coreutils (chmod, chown, cat), shadow-utils (useradd, groupadd, userdel, groupdel), net-tools스크립트 실행을 허용하도록/tmp디렉토리에 마운트 지점을 구성합니다.
- Windows 요구 사항
- Visual C++ 버전은 14 이상이어야 합니다.
- Windows OS VM의 성능 모니터링을 활성화해야 합니다.
- Windows 2012 R2 요구 사항대상 시스템을 범용 C 런타임으로 업데이트해야 합니다. 자세한 내용은 다음 링크를 참조하십시오.
- VMware Tools는 에이전트를 설치하려는vCenter ServerVM에 설치되어 실행 중이어야 합니다. 지원되는 VMware Tools 버전에 대한 자세한 내용을 보려면 이 링크를 클릭하십시오.vCenter Server클라우드 계정으로 관리되는 VM에만 적용됩니다.
- 최신 UAG Photon OS VM에 에이전트를 설치하려면 "실행" 권한이 있는tmp폴더를 추가합니다. 스크립트 실행을 허용하도록/tmp디렉토리에 마운트 지점을 구성하려면 다음 명령을 실행합니다.<mount -o remount,exec /tmp>